About Metronome by Veronique Tanaka: “A bold pushing of the formalĀ envelope, it bills itself as a ‘visual poem’, but with its regimented film-like frames and hypnotic four-four repetition, it evokes music and stroboscopic cinema.” The Boston Phoenix

New York Magazine has just announced their top ten in all things culture and that includes a list of top ten Graphic Novels where our Veronique Tanaka’s arresting silent GN Metronome is seventh tied with another silent GN called Travel.
